    It’s become the norm to diss Chris Gunter when it comes to Wales selection lately. I get that and agreed that the time had come to move on from the likes of him and Jonny Williams - well, it seems that Gunts agrees because he’s announced his retirement from international football.

    Wales defender Chris Gunter retires from international football at the age of 33.


    Rob Phillips has written a warm and perceptive review of Gunter’s international career there and all I’ll add is, despite him not being more than a good Championship player when it came to club football, you’d could count the number of times he was “found out” in a Wales shirt on the fingers of one hand - in fact, I can’t think of one really poor game he had for his country.

          nice statement from him

          "I’ve had the privilege of representing our great country for 15 years, and it’s given me some of the best times of my career and my life.

          To all of the managers I’ve played under, and all of the staff who have helped me in many different ways, I have so much appreciation for you and need to say a huge thank you.

          I’ve always said when you can share moments with not just team mates but friends it’s even more special, and I’ve been so lucky to share the dressing room with people who are real mates for life.

          From a young kid growing up in Wales the dream was to always play and wear that red shirt. What not even I dreamt of was the memories and experiences it has given me and my family.

          Which has been made possible by you lot, the fans. I’ve tried to tell you many times how much you’ve helped, although it’s hard to find the words to articulate. So I’ll just say the biggest thank you, and see you soon.

          We’re in a great place with this staff and squad, with loads to look forward to.

          Gunts"
